I've been doing these for about 6 months and you absolutely have explosive trap growth visible on almost on a weekly basis, it's amazing. For the first few week you will feel it all the way to the glutes but after a while your back catches up and you mostly feel it in the traps. When you first start don't go up in weight until you hit 10 reps on your top set with a given weight to allow your back time to catch up and prevent that hidden weakness in your chain to be missed.
